Transaction 7045ce9515511a86a2411d5335890ec09bbc26f79e972037b46e22f4d28f3cc1

1 Input
2 Outputs
  • 7045ce9515511a86a2411d5335890ec09bbc26f79e972037b46e22f4d28f3cc1:0
  • value  105049157
    address  1EzdVrRtVcu1QBXHYSUkdynvo9wTrq9XGY
  • 7045ce9515511a86a2411d5335890ec09bbc26f79e972037b46e22f4d28f3cc1:1
  • value  705273
    address  121y4NMJ4fzbBnH6HLwFDfButoVi6WQu4C